21 references to Expire
Microsoft.AspNetCore.OutputCaching (1)
OutputCacheAttribute.cs (1)
114builder.Expire(TimeSpan.FromSeconds(_duration.Value));
Microsoft.AspNetCore.OutputCaching.Tests (18)
DefaultOutputCachePolicyProviderTests.cs (10)
16var policy1 = new OutputCachePolicyBuilder().Expire(TimeSpan.FromMinutes(5)).Build(); 17var policy2 = new OutputCachePolicyBuilder().Expire(TimeSpan.FromMinutes(10)).Build(); 55var policy = new OutputCachePolicyBuilder().Expire(TimeSpan.FromMinutes(15)).Build(); 77var policy = new OutputCachePolicyBuilder().Expire(TimeSpan.FromSeconds(30)).Build(); 111var policy1 = new OutputCachePolicyBuilder().Expire(TimeSpan.FromMinutes(5)).Build(); 112var policy2 = new OutputCachePolicyBuilder().Expire(TimeSpan.FromMinutes(10)).Build(); 113var policy3 = new OutputCachePolicyBuilder().Expire(TimeSpan.FromMinutes(15)).Build(); 138var policy = new OutputCachePolicyBuilder().Expire(TimeSpan.FromMinutes(20)).Build(); 160options.AddBasePolicy(builder => builder.Expire(TimeSpan.FromMinutes(30))); 179.Expire(TimeSpan.FromMinutes(45))
OutputCacheAttributeTests.cs (1)
49options.AddPolicy("MyPolicy", b => b.Expire(TimeSpan.FromSeconds(42)));
OutputCachePolicyBuilderTests.cs (7)
36var policy = builder.Expire(TimeSpan.FromSeconds(duration)).Build(); 61options.AddPolicy(name, b => b.Expire(TimeSpan.FromSeconds(duration))); 79options.AddPolicy(name, b => b.Expire(TimeSpan.FromSeconds(duration)), true); 333options.AddBasePolicy(build => build.Expire(TimeSpan.FromSeconds(1))); 334options.AddBasePolicy(build => build.With(c => source == 1).Expire(TimeSpan.FromSeconds(2))); 335options.AddBasePolicy(build => build.With(c => source == 2).Expire(TimeSpan.FromSeconds(3))); 353options.AddBasePolicy(build => build.With(c => false).Expire(TimeSpan.FromSeconds(2)));
OutputCachingSample (2)
Startup.cs (2)
12options.AddBasePolicy(builder => builder.With(c => c.HttpContext.Request.Path.StartsWithSegments("/js")).Expire(TimeSpan.FromDays(1))); 55}).CacheOutput(p => p.SetLocking(false).Expire(TimeSpan.FromMilliseconds(1)));